This car actually sold last month on E-Bay. When buyer came to pick it up, there was a problem getting it to start. The buyer actually preferred another Corvette that I had, so bought that one, instead. I found the starting issue to be a bad ignition coil, and the car again starts and runs as it should. I am, therefore, relisting it. This is a nice driver car, that just needs a little finishing. When I got it, all four radio speakers had been removed, and I have not replaced them. The "air bag" light and "ABS" light on dash are illuminated, and I do not know why. The air conditioning is all complete, but does not operate. I have not tried to trouble-shoot the problem. Original color was green, car is now black. Paint is what I would call "fair". A few places have been touched-up, and could be improved upon with a little color-sanding and/or buffing. Engine runs very well, and trans and clutch are very smooth. Tires are good, as are brakes. All gauges seem to work properly. With a little work, this could be an excellent car.
